Brief summary

Relapsed and refractory Hodgkin's lymphoma (HL) patients may experience long-term survival after allogeneic transplant (alloSCT), but disease recurrence represents the main cause of treatment failure. PET (positron-emission tomography) -positive patients after alloSCT have a dismal outcome. Serum TARC (thymus and activation-regulated chemokine) is produced by Reed-Sternberg cells and may be a marker of disease. Our study was aimed at assessing whether TARC levels after alloSCT were correlated to disease status and whether TARC monitoring could increase the ability to predict relapse.
